Identify Fake Forex Brokers
Wiki Article
Investing in the forex market can be lucrative, but it's crucial to be cautious and avoid falling victim to scams. Many fraudulent brokers prey on unsuspecting traders, promising unrealistic returns and disappearing with investors' money. To protect yourself, learn to distinguish red flags and select legitimate brokers. One key indicator is a broker's licensing. Reputable brokers are regulated by recognized financial authorities. Always confirm the broker's credentials on official regulatory websites.
- Scrutinize promises of guaranteed profits or exceptionally high returns. These are often red flags for scams.
- Research the broker's background and reputation thoroughly before creating an account.
- Examine for clear and transparent fee structures, avoiding brokers with hidden or exorbitant costs.
Remember, if something seems too good to be true, it probably is. Be aware and prioritize your financial safety by dealing only with reputable forex brokers.

Red Flags of Broker Scams: Be Aware Before Investing
Investing your hard-earned money can be exciting, but it's crucial to stay alert and recognize the warning signs of a broker scam. Fraudulent brokers often employ manipulative tactics to lure unsuspecting investors. One major red flag is a broker who promises unrealistically high returns with little to no risk. This is simply not possible in legitimate investments.
Another warning sign is pressure to act immediately. Scammers often create a sense of urgency to prevent you from thinking things through carefully.

Is Your Broker Legit? Essential Tips for Verification
Navigating the crypto platform reviews world of finance can be complex, and choosing the right broker is paramount. To avoid falling victim to scams or dishonest practices, it's crucial to verify your broker's legitimacy before entrusting them with your assets. Here are some essential tips to help you determine if your broker is on the up and up.
- Thoroughly research your broker's background. Look for reviews, ratings, and any legal filings that shed light on their history and practices.
- Check if your broker is authorized with the relevant regulatory bodies in your area. This ensures they are operating within legal boundaries and adhering to industry norms.
- Be wary of brokers who make unrealistic claims or guarantee high returns with little risk. If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
- Reach out directly to your broker and ask questions about their policies. A legitimate broker will be transparent and willing to provide you with the information you need.
Remember, your financial well-being is paramount. By taking the time to ensure your broker's legitimacy, you can minimize your risk and make informed investment decisions.
